Simon peter was the son of jonas who was a fisherman and lived in bethsaida and capernaum. He was a member of the inner circle of jesus, and he did his missionary and evangelistic work as far as babylon. He was the author of two books in the bible, namely 1st peter and 2nd peter.

The competition is the second book in donna russo morin's da vinci's disciples series. In this book, the women of the first book are back and have been continuing to work and hone their skills under master painter leonardo da vinci. Florence is a buzz with a competition to paint a fresco in the famous santo spirito.
